
A minibus carrying Chinese tourists yesterday crashed on the Indonesian resort island of Bali, killing five and leaving eight others injured, police said.
The minibus was on a curved and sloping road in the Buleleng district, which is on the northern side of the island, when the crash happened.
Five Chinese tourists – three women, and two men – died in the accident, while the driver and eight other passengers suffered minor injuries, the police said. “The driver was unable to control the vehicle… the vehicle crashed into a farm, collided with a tree,” a traffic police officer said.
